the muse: Material toughness as the First Line of Longevity
The journey to a longer-lasting helmet starts with its very composition. State-of-the-art materials science plays a pivotal function in defining how properly a helmet withstands the rigors of its supposed use. large-overall performance thermoplastics, which include Acrylonitrile Butadiene Styrene (ABS), are often specified for top-depth rescue helmet shells. ABS provides an Excellent harmony of properties: it boasts high tensile energy and rigidity, delivering robust resistance versus impacts from slipping debris or collisions. Critically, it maintains its structural integrity across An array of temperatures, resisting the brittleness which will plague lesser resources in chilly disorders and also the softening which will take place underneath Serious warmth, common in firefighting situations.
Beyond effects resistance, the materials Utilized in a helmet Enjoy a critical role in its toughness in opposition to environmental and chemical troubles. Rescue functions expose products to powerful UV radiation, large humidity, water, and chemical compounds like oils and fuels. Helmets made out of products immune to chemical corrosion and UV destruction very last longer, preventing fading, cracking, or polymer breakdown that will weaken equally their seem and defense. Abrasion resistance can be necessary. Regular dealing with, surface area Speak to, and storage can put on down inferior shells, perhaps compromising protective levels. long lasting products ensure the helmet continues to be powerful and presentable by recurring use, delaying substitution as a result of floor put on.
created to Endure: The crucial purpose of Structural Strength structure
though product preference provides the making blocks, the architectural design on the helmet is equally critical for longevity. How forces are distributed on influence, how the factors integrate, and the overall structural rigidity determine how perfectly the helmet resists harm and dress in above its life span. Modern rescue helmets frequently employ sophisticated internal suspension programs, such as multi-level harnesses (like six-stage systems). These layouts do additional than simply increase consolation and match; they distribute the power of an impact across a broader location from the shell as well as wearer's head. This considerably lowers stress focus on any solitary position, minimizing the potential risk of localized problems or cracking that would necessitate premature substitute.
The mixing involving the outer shell and also the internal liner (normally EPS foam for shock absorption) is an additional significant structure consideration. A seamless, strong bond between these layers prevents delamination or separation, challenges that can arise from recurring impacts, temperature fluctuations, or simply the growing older of adhesives. An built-in construction maintains the helmet's overall security and protecting functionality for extended. Also, style and design components focusing on inherent resistance to deformation are key. Helmets designed to resist crushing forces or sizeable impacts without having permanently warping or cracking are basically much more tough. They may be not as likely to generally be rendered unusable by the sort of incidental drops, bumps, or compressive forces that take place frequently in Lively rescue environments. This inherent toughness instantly translates into a longer services everyday living, lowering the frequency of replacements triggered by accidental harm.
Smart Sustainability: The Power of Replaceable factors and Modularity
a major element contributing towards the untimely disposal of basic safety gear is definitely the failure of one, typically insignificant, part. a standard helmet style may necessitate discarding your entire unit if a chin strap frays, a sweatband wears out, or a visor receives scratched. This is when modularity presents a robust edge for extending product or service lifespan and lowering waste. Helmets intended with quickly replaceable factors shift the paradigm from wholesale replacement to specific repair service and refurbishment.
CComponents like chin straps, suspension harnesses, sweatbands, nape straps, and visors or goggles endure essentially the most don because of contact with the consumer and exposure to sweat, Dust, and tension. Designing these pieces as modular and consumer-replaceable lets speedy, Expense-efficient swaps when needed, restoring the helmet without discarding the strong shell. This lessens squander significantly, as only modest, worn-out elements are changed in lieu of the entire helmet. It also lowers the environmental influence by minimizing disposal and resource use. Additionally, replaceable visors and extras enable customization, like including or swapping helmet shields for unique requires or branding, without having a completely new helmet. The financial Advantages are crystal clear—alternative components Value considerably a lot less than a different helmet, preserving dollars Ultimately.
efficiency That Lasts: guaranteeing dependable Protection eventually
Safety certifications, such as EN 397 (Industrial security Helmets) or specific firefighting standards like EN 443, are critical indicators of the helmet's First protective abilities. on the other hand, true longevity requires that these protective features continue being steady throughout the helmet's supposed provider daily life. Helmets developed with substantial-high-quality products and sturdy development are considerably less susceptible to degradation that can compromise their effectiveness with time. Certifications signify the helmet achieved arduous screening specifications for influence absorption, penetration resistance, flame resistance (wherever relevant), and electrical insulation at the point of manufacture.
A properly-engineered helmet maintains these Homes even soon after prolonged exposure to operational stresses and environmental aspects. The components resist degradation from UV light-weight, temperature cycles, and small impacts, ensuring the shell doesn't become brittle or reduce its shock-absorbing capacity prematurely. The integrity of the suspension process continues to be reputable, making sure dependable match and affect distribution. This sustained efficiency is essential not only for user safety and also for longevity. Helmets that promptly degrade in protecting functionality, even when they seem physically intact, has to be retired early. By buying helmets made for functionality security, companies lessen the risk of needing to switch gear just because its Accredited defense degree can no more be certain resulting from age or use. This makes sure ongoing compliance and user basic safety when simultaneously extending the viable lifespan on the asset.

made for Duty: the value of quick Maintenance and Cleaning
the benefit with which a helmet may be cleaned and preserved instantly impacts its usability and lifespan. Helmets Utilized in rescue environments inevitably get dirty, exposed to soot, grime, bodily fluids, oils, and also other contaminants. Equipment that is certainly tough to clean up might be neglected, bringing about material degradation, unpleasant person ordeals, or simply likely wellbeing hazards. even worse, if cleaning procedures are much too harsh or complicated, they might inadvertently destruction the helmet components after some time.
Helmets created with smooth, non-porous outer shells manufactured from components proof against prevalent chemical substances and grime are significantly simpler to take care of. Surfaces that easily drop dirt and may be wiped clean with straightforward, authorised cleaning agents ensure that decontamination protocols is often adopted efficiently devoid of detrimental the helmet. Features like detachable and washable inside elements (sweatbands, liners) even further increase hygiene and consumer consolation, prolonging the desirability of utilizing the helmet. easy, company-proposed upkeep methods – like periodic inspection of straps and buckles, checking the integrity from the shell, and correct cleansing – are simpler to adhere to if the helmet's structure facilitates them. This proactive treatment prevents small problems from escalating and will help ensure the helmet reaches its optimum opportunity services lifestyle, decreasing the likelihood of it remaining discarded prematurely on account of lousy situation or hygiene issues.
